Output ebee2f12e1ab149d7c3785bd0e62dc942eab6af58e4db4e8fad05d2bc1557735:2

value
17963790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c5da5e376dee80db20429249a8e3ae8ba4ff5b2 OP_EQUAL
address
3Js19PHptdSXxPX8REHs69JrLFadGeqg5h
transaction
ebee2f12e1ab149d7c3785bd0e62dc942eab6af58e4db4e8fad05d2bc1557735
confirmations
432230
spent
true